References(4)
Brusca, R.C.; Brusca, G.J. (1990). Invertebrates. Sinauer Associates: Sunderland, MA (USA). ISBN 0-87893-098-1. 922 pp.
Ho, J.S. (1990). Phylogenetic analysis of copepod orders. Journal of Crustacean Biology 10(3):528-536.
Ho, J.S. (1994). Copepod phylogeny: a reconsideration of Huys & Boxshall's 'parsimony versus homology'. In: Ferrari, F.D. & B.P. Bradley (eds.). Ecology and Morphology of Copepods. Developments in Hydrobiology 102, Hydrobiologia 292/293:31-39, fig.1-4, tab.1-4.
Milne Edwards, H. (1840). Ordre des Copépodes. [Order Copepoda]. <em>Histoire naturelle des Crustaces, comprenant l'anatomie, la physiologie et la classification de ces animaux. [In: Natural history of Crustacea, including the anatomy, physiology and classification of these animals]].</em> 3: 411-529.
